3rd International Workshop on Epitaxial Growth and Fundamental Properties of Semiconductor Nanostructures (SemiconNano 2011)

The workshop SemiconNano-2011 covers all aspects of growth, characterization, modelling and applications of self-assembled epitaxial nanostructures, with particular focus on SiGe, III-V, II-VI, IV-VI and magnetic semiconductors, graphene and oxides. Principal topics: Growth dynamics: Nucleation and growth evolution of epitaxial or catalyzed nanostructures, including in situ techniques such as STM, TEM, electron and x-ray diffraction. Ordering and site-control: Growth on patterned substrates for spatial control, effects of termination and reconstruction of crystal surfaces, growth on high-indexed substrates. Theory: Fundamental theory and first principles methods, kinetic Monte Carlo modeling, multi-scale modeling of growth, theory of electronic properties. Properties of nano-scale structures and advanced characterization methods: Morphological, structural and electronic properties of low dimensional structures such as quantum dots, rings, dot molecules, wires and nano-rods. Includes novel approaches such as cross-sectional STM/AFM, tomography, synchrotron scattering, electron microscopy and optical spectroscopy. Device applications: Application of epitaxial nanostructures for optoelectronic devices, quantum computation and energy harvesting. This also includes novel concepts and integration with photonic structures.
